OpenNebula federation approach is that followed by commercial cloud
providers. Users, groups and access control policies are fedarated across
zones. However, networking, compute and storage resources are local to each
zone.

Typically you'll configure Datastores (of any type Ceph, Gluster, LVMs...)
for each zone. Sharing of images across zones can be achivied by a
marketplace.
